The primary way to reach Sisters' Island is by speedboat or ferry from Singapore Harbour, taking about 30 minutes. Speedboats offer faster travel and fewer departures, ideal for time-conscious travelers, while ferries operated by local tour companies often include guided tours, perfect for those seeking immersive experiences. HopeGoo in advance through official tourism platforms or travel agencies is recommended, especially during weekends and holidays due to high demand.

Vehicles are not allowed on the island, so all luggage must be carried by hand or via pushcart—pack light and wear comfortable footwear. For added convenience, some resorts on Sentosa offer dedicated shuttle boats to Sisters' Island as part of integrated packages, combining transport, snorkeling, and guided walks into one seamless experience.

Sisters' Island is renowned for its pristine shoreline and vibrant marine life, making these activities essential:

  • Snorkeling Adventure: Explore coral reefs teeming with clownfish, butterflyfish, and other tropical species. Rental gear is available at designated safe zones.

  • Island Trail Hiking: A 2-kilometer loop winds through tropical jungle and sandy beaches, offering sightings of mangroves and native birds—best enjoyed at sunrise or sunset.

  • Sunset Viewing: The western beach offers unobstructed views of Singapore’s skyline blending with golden twilight hues—perfect for photography and quiet reflection.

  • Eco-Tours: Local operators provide guided nature walks led by certified naturalists, sharing insights on flora, intertidal creatures, and conservation efforts.

Note: Camping, open fires, and single-use plastics are prohibited. Bring reusable water bottles and trash bags to help preserve this fragile ecosystem.

Sisters' Island is ideal for family visits due to its quiet, safe, and natural environment with no vehicle traffic. Designated shallow snorkeling zones feature clear, calm waters perfect for kids to explore marine life under parental supervision. The island trail is flat and wide, stroller-friendly, with benches and signage along the way.

Some tour packages include children’s eco-workshops such as identifying tide pool creatures and crafting natural floaters—engaging and educational. While there are no restaurants, visitors can bring simple food and enjoy picnics at designated areas. Parents should pack sunscreen, insect repellent, and ample drinking water, and follow the "leave no trace" principle to protect the island’s delicate ecosystem.
